The meet-up location for this photoshoot is at Pont de Bir Hakeim, a picturesque bridge offering fantastic views of the Eiffel Tower. The photographer will contact you ahead of time to confirm your preferred meeting point, with your name displayed on the phone. The photographer always has a visible camera around the neck for easy identification.
From this central location, the photographer guides you through a 30-minute walk that includes photo stops at notable Parisian sites, such as the Eiffel Tower and the Louvre. The customizable locations allow for changes if requested 24+ hours in advance, providing flexibility for special requests like additional landmarks or alternative settings.
The meeting process is straightforward: the photographer ensures clear communication and is always approachable, making it easy to find each other regardless of your initial arrival point. The group size remains private, offering an intimate and relaxed experience.

What is the price of this photoshoot?
The tour costs $43 per group of up to 6 people.
How long does the photoshoot last?
Session durations range from 15 minutes to 1 hour, based on your choice.
Where does the photoshoot start?
The meeting point is Pont de Bir Hakeim, with the photographer contacting you beforehand.
Are the photos professionally retouched?
Yes, carefully retouched digital photos are delivered within 48 hours, with adjustments to shadows, highlights, and colors.
Can I request specific locations?
Yes, location requests are accepted 24+ hours in advance and can include landmarks like the Louvre or Arc de Triomphe.
Is this experience accessible for wheelchair users?
Yes, the experience is wheelchair accessible.
How do I find the photographer on the day?
The photographer will have your name on the phone and a visible camera around the neck for easy identification.
What should I bring?
A charged smartphone is recommended for communication purposes.
Is there a cancellation policy?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
How quickly will I receive my photos?
Digital photos are sent within 48 hours of the shoot, fully edited and high-quality.
